Member Engagment Specialist
Pay: From $16.00 per hour
Job description:
Membership Engagement Specialist
The Membership Engagement Specialist will need to possess an inclusive knowledge of the credit union’s loan policies and procedures, data processing procedures, and relevant regulations. This position also requires extensive knowledge of the core processing system.
Reports to: Branch Manager
Status: Full-time (40 hours)
PTO: 16 Days Plus 3 Emergency Days
Compensation: Base Pay, Loan Incentives, Holiday Bonus
Benefits: Employer Paid Medical, Dental, Vision, Short and Long Term Disability
